Help me understand this formula "Total score = (100-plat rarity) x playtime multiplier x (1 - [points unlocked / total trophy list points for the main game])". Using Uncharted: The Lost Legacy as an example. If I unlock all the trophy, I will get 1-(1230/1230)=0. That means my total score will be 0.

Just now, GTA_Darren said:

Help me understand this formula "Total score = (100-plat rarity) x playtime multiplier x (1 - [points unlocked / total trophy list points for the main game])". Using Uncharted: The Lost Legacy as an example. If I unlock all the trophy, I will get 1-(1230/1230)=0. That means my total score will be 0.

That last part (the point penalty) is only if you've started the game prior to the start of the contest. Games that are started afterwards don't have that. In the spreadsheet there will be an IF formula that will determine that.
